‘Fabricate’ was presented at the group exhibition ‘Variability’ as part of the Icon Design Trail during the London Design Festival 2010.

The basic components from the ‘Fabricate’ flat pack include a spiral wire frame, an electric light fitting, and the light shade itself, which is a piece of fabric with a pocket (or pockets) woven in. The pocket houses the spiral frame that provides a skeleton that creates a sphere at the centre of which lies the light fitting. There are many factors in the fabric that could be altered. For instance, the yarn could be different colour, different make, which means unlimited possibilities of different pattern; the shape of the pocket could be square, round or even oval; and if one has a big room and needs something big and impressive instead of compact and intimate, then instead of cutting the fabric into units of pockets, one could make one’s own configuration by cutting out a line of three pockets or a square of nine.

DESIGNER: Studio Henny van Nistelrooy, London UK, www.studiohvn.com. DESCRIPTION: Lighting. DATE: 2010.
